Watercolor Friendship Mountains In-Person
Watercolor Friendship Mountains
- Art Activity: Watercolor painting of mountains.
- Objective: Explore the characteristics of healthy friendships while students work to create the layers of their mountain painting. The drying time provides an opportunity for group discussion on what makes a good friend and how to set expectations in friendships.
Part 1 of a 4 Part Series, Empowering Healthy Relationships through Art presented by SafeHouse. This program uses art-based activities to help students explore and understand key concepts around healthy relationships, boundaries, digital safety, and self-expression.
Program is open to rising 6th graders through 12th grade.
